diff --git a/frontend/build.ts b/frontend/build.ts index 5b92fe8..827d9e1 100644 --- a/frontend/build.ts +++ b/frontend/build.ts @@ -11,6 +11,9 @@ import { renderGebuehrentabellen } from "./src/gebuehrentabellen"; import { renderChecklisten } from "./src/checklisten"; import { renderChecklistenDetail } from "./src/checklisten-detail"; import { renderGerichte } from "./src/gerichte"; +import { renderAkten } from "./src/akten"; +import { renderAktenNeu } from "./src/akten-neu"; +import { renderAktenDetail } from "./src/akten-detail"; const DIST = join(import.meta.dir, "dist"); @@ -33,6 +36,9 @@ async function build() { join(import.meta.dir, "src/client/checklisten.ts"), join(import.meta.dir, "src/client/checklisten-detail.ts"), join(import.meta.dir, "src/client/gerichte.ts"), + join(import.meta.dir, "src/client/akten.ts"), + join(import.meta.dir, "src/client/akten-neu.ts"), + join(import.meta.dir, "src/client/akten-detail.ts"), ], outdir: join(DIST, "assets"), naming: "[name].js", @@ -65,6 +71,9 @@ async function build() { await Bun.write(join(DIST, "checklisten.html"), renderChecklisten()); await Bun.write(join(DIST, "checklisten-detail.html"), renderChecklistenDetail()); await Bun.write(join(DIST, "gerichte.html"), renderGerichte()); + await Bun.write(join(DIST, "akten.html"), renderAkten()); + await Bun.write(join(DIST, "akten-neu.html"), renderAktenNeu()); + await Bun.write(join(DIST, "akten-detail.html"), renderAktenDetail()); console.log("Build complete \u2192 dist/"); } diff --git a/frontend/src/akten-detail.tsx b/frontend/src/akten-detail.tsx new file mode 100644 index 0000000..9c11050 --- /dev/null +++ b/frontend/src/akten-detail.tsx @@ -0,0 +1,195 @@ +import { h } from "./jsx"; +import { Sidebar } from "./components/Sidebar"; +import { Footer } from "./components/Footer"; + +export function renderAktenDetail(): string { + return "" + ( + + + + + Akte — Paliad + + + + + +
+
+
+ ← Zurück zur Übersicht + +
+

Lädt…

+
+ + + + + + {/* Delete confirmation modal */} + +
+
+
+ +